In-situ growth of Ni2P nanoparticles on Hierarchical Porous Graphitic Carbon as super stable anode material for sodium ion batteries

  Sodium-ion batteries have recently gained a lot of interest due to its low cost and widely applications.However,the main challenge is to develop an anode material with superior high-rate capability and long-term cycling stability.Here,we initiatively applied Ni2P nanoparticles in-situ grown on hierarchical porous graphitic carbon(HPGC)that synthesized by chemical vapor deposition method as anode material of sodium ion batteries.The Ni2P/HPGC composite shows a high reversible specific capacity of 489 mAh g-1 at the current density of 100 mA g-1 and a good long-term cycle stability for 2000 cycles,which exhibits an excellent rate performance and cycling stability.
